Jack Reed - Class Of 1946

Jack W. Reed  July 9, 1928-March 6, 2004 BEATRICE -- Jack W. Reed, 75, died Saturday (March 6, 2004) in Beatrice. He was born July 9, 1928, in Orleans. He was a 1946 graduate of McCook High School and received his bachelor of science degree in engineering from the University of Nebraska at Lincoln in 1951. He was employed with the Nebraska Department of Roads and was Vice-president of mining for Peter Kiewit and Sons in Omaha until he retired in 1986. He lived in Elkhorn, Wickenburg, Ariz., and Beatrice. On May 18, 1985, he married Eunice (Reinke) Carpenter in Las Vegas, Nev. He was a member of the St. John Lutheran Church in Beatrice, a former member of Bethany Lutheran Church in Wickenburg, the Elks Club, American Legion Club, Sportsmen's Club, Classic Car Club, Chamber of Commerce volunteer and was volunteer at the Cabaleroes Western Museum, all in Arizona, and the Arizona Rangers. He was a past member of the Midwest Trail Riders in Elkhorn. He was preceded in death by his parents; first wife, Donna Gayl Reed; and granddaughter, Alexandra Salem Reed.
